手抄报 安全手抄报 手抄报内容 手抄报图片 英语手抄报 清明节手抄报 节约用水手抄报

Java 给 PDF 设置背景图片

时间:2024-10-14 13:34:37

本条经验将为大家详细介绍如何使用Spire.PDF for Java为PDF文档设置背景图片,使其更加美观。

工具/原料

Spire.PDF for Java

jar包导入

1、步骤一:在java程序中新建一个文件夹可命名为Lib,下载安装好后,解压,将解压后的文件夹下的子文件夹lib 中的jar包导入到project中。

Java 给 PDF 设置背景图片

2、步骤二:点击“File-Project Structure-Modules-Dependencies-'+'-Jars and directories-添加jar包”,完成引用。

Java 给 PDF 设置背景图片

代码示例

1、import com.spire.pdf.PdfDocument;import com.spire.pdf.PdfPageBase;import java.awt.*;public class SetBackgroundImage { public static void main(String[] args) { //加载PDF文档 PdfDocument doc = new PdfDocument(); doc.loadFromFile("original.pdf"); PdfPageBase page; //获取文档的总页数 int pageCount = doc.getPages().getCount(); //遍历页面,设置背景图片 for(int i = 0; i < pageCount; i ++) { page = doc.getPages().get(i); page.setBackgroundImage("Background.jpg"); } //保存文档 doc.saveToFile("BackgroundImage.pdf"); }}

2、完成代码后,运行程序,原文档与现文档对比效果如下:

Java 给 PDF 设置背景图片
Java 给 PDF 设置背景图片
© 手抄报圈